Rent & eviction protection

Is 2638-2642 Larkin St rent-controlled?

San Francisco's Rent Ordinance caps rent increases and provides eviction protection for most residential units built before 1979 with 2+ units. Here's how this building scores.

Likely rent-controlled. Building age and unit count suggest this property falls under San Francisco's Rent Ordinance.

Based on SF Assessor records. Not legal advice — confirm with the SF Rent Board.

AI summary

The three-unit multi-family residential building at 2638-2642 Larkin Street in Russian Hill, owned by the May Family Trust since 2003, has undergone several significant improvements since its construction in 1900. Most notably, the property has seen substantial infrastructure updates including the installation of a solar system in 2019 (2.722 kW with 9 modules), a direct vent gas appliance in 2017, and a series of sprinkler system modifications between 1998-1999 which, while initially approved in 1998, went through multiple revisions and renewals until 2000. A major project in 1997 involved stabilizing a hillside and converting a garage front deck to concrete, though this permit ultimately expired. The building has had several routine housing inspections (2000, 2004, and 2006) with no noted violations, and there were two building complaints in 2013 related to adjacent construction at 2632 Larkin Street, primarily concerning alleged work hours and duration.

Recent historical data shows various community-related incidents around the property, mostly involving parking issues and street maintenance concerns, with the most recent occurrences between 2019-2022. These included multiple reports of vehicles blocking driveways or parking on sidewalks, and several complaints about loose garbage on the street. All these 311 calls were addressed by city departments, with most either being resolved or requiring no further action. The building's permit history suggests regular maintenance and upgrading of systems, particularly in the late 1990s/early 2000s, though some permits from that period were marked as expired.

How 2638-2642 Larkin St's risk score is calculated

We trained a model on 7 years of SF DBI inspection data — notice of violation filings, complaint history, and owner track records. It estimates the probability that DBI inspectors will issue a Notice of Violation at this address in the next 12 months. Lower % = safer.

What the score means for you

Grade A–B — Low risk

DBI rarely finds violations here. Strong maintenance history and a clean complaint record.

Grade C — Moderate risk

Some past violations or complaints on record. Worth asking the landlord about any open issues before signing.

Grade D–F — High risk

Elevated violation and complaint history. DBI has found issues here before and is statistically likely to again.
